I tested each thread combination - four different ways - 
  • Regulated Cruise - 10 stitches per inch
  • Regulated Cruise - 14 stitches per inch
  • Regulated Precise - 10 stitches per inch 
  • Regulated Precise - 14 stitches per inch 
 
I haven't thoroughly analyzed all of the results yet -
 
But I did notice that she didn't particularly like the "Regulated Precise" mode -
 
Nor did she like the 14 stitches per inch - 
 
So tomorrow I'll narrow it down to the "Regulated Cruise" mode - 
 
And 10 stitches per inch -

Then re-test the same combinations -
 
Plus a few more just for fun -
 
I think she likes 50 wt. polyester best -
